1 Results for *squamaceou*
หรือค้นหา: squamaceou, -squamaceou-

Collaborative International Dictionary (GCIDE)
Squamaceous

a. Squamose. [ 1913 Webster ]


Time: 2.6662 secondsLongdo Dict -- https://dict.longdo.com/